Quantinno Capital Management LP Boosts Position in Morningstar, Inc. (NASDAQ:MORN)

Quantinno Capital Management LP grew its position in shares of Morningstar, Inc. (NASDAQ:MORNFree Report) by 25.1% during the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The fund owned 6,924 shares of the business services provider’s stock after purchasing an additional 1,390 shares during the quarter. Quantinno Capital Management LP’s holdings in Morningstar were worth $2,332,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

Morningstar Stock Performance

Shares of NASDAQ MORN opened at $310.44 on Wednesday. The stock has a market capitalization of $13.12 billion, a P/E ratio of 41.01 and a beta of 0.99. The firm’s 50-day moving average price is $289.05 and its two-hundred day moving average price is $316.93. The company has a quick ratio of 1.14, a current ratio of 1.14 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.55. Morningstar, Inc. has a 52-week low of $250.34 and a 52-week high of $365.00.

Morningstar (NASDAQ:MORNG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, April 30th. The business services provider reported $2.23 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.10 by $0.13. The business had revenue of $581.90 million for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$589.07 million. Morningstar had a net margin of 14.69% and a return on equity of 23.28%.

Morningstar Increases Dividend

The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Wednesday, April 30th. Stockholders of record on Friday, April 4th were issued a $0.455 dividend. This is an increase from Morningstar’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.41.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Friday, April 4th. This represents a $1.82 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 0.59%. Morningstar’s dividend payout ratio is currently 20.45%.

Morningstar Company Profile

(Free Report)

Morningstar, Inc provides independent investment insights in the United States, Asia. Australia, Continental Europe, the United Kingdom, and internationally. The company operates in five segments: Morningstar Data and Analytics; PitchBook; Morningstar Wealth; Morningstar Credit; and Morningstar Retirement.
